Summary
A cream fine cotton shaped collar, embroidered in a broderie anglaise style. The collar is decorated with strips of flowers and leaves, with one large and two smaller circles filled with bars to give a squared effect. These are surrounded with stitched flower motifs. The collar is edged with a broad scalloped edged cotton lace. The neckline is edged with a narrow band of cotton lace, with a large metal hook to fasten. The lace edging is coming away at one edge.
